Roanoke Rapids Hospital Delays Decision on Operation
At the September board meeting trustees weighed the hospital's viability amid a strike and fund shortages. No action was taken and a decision was postponed to next week while emergency cases only are admitted. Estimates show about 3000 dollars weekly in operating costs and roughly 6642 dollars monthly.

Warsaw Couple Injured in Car Overturn on Richmond Highway
Mr and Mrs Albert Askew of Warsaw North Carolina were injured when their car overturned near the city on the Richmond highway last Saturday night. Mrs Askew remained in Roanoke Rapids Hospital with injuries reported as serious while Mr Askew had minor cuts and was discharged after first aid. The couple was returning from Richmond when the crash occurred as Albert Askew avoided a vehicle approaching from a side road. Mr and Mrs Page Taylor of Richmond assisted and transported the Askews to Roanoke Rapids Hospital.

Condition of Tyler Improves After Car Crash
The condition of George Tyler a prominent city mail carrier is much improved Dr C C Coleman of Richmond said after he operated Sunday Tyler was injured when his car overturned near La Crosse Va last Thursday night Sept 6 Earl Rook the other occupant received treatment for minor injuries and was discharged Tyler later at Roanoke Rapids Hospital X ray showed a broken back and initial fears of spinal cord severing proved unfounded though paralysis remains a concern

Rosemary workers seek governor protection to return to work
Rose mary Textile Workers union members pleads with Governor Ehringhaus for protection to go back to Rosemary Manufacturing Co. after two week halt. The local action notes 600 of 850 on payroll joined home union and blames pickets from other mills for forcing absence. No decision reported as Adjutant General Metts considers the request.

Shaheen Injured in Weldon Road Truck Crash
Leo Shaheen suffered a leg fracture when a Weldon Ice Co truck overturned near the Country Club entrance on Weldon Road Sunday afternoon. He is hospitalized at Roanoke Rapids Hospital awaiting further medical decisions as surgeons consider the possibility of amputation.
